Transaction 156f4ae5e84c2a86f70fff333edc20e38e9299e6db65f43295c2e49813665b53

1 Input
2 Outputs
  • 156f4ae5e84c2a86f70fff333edc20e38e9299e6db65f43295c2e49813665b53:0
  • value  5268719
    address  3L4DwsK4NfnHYrgiSLPi3wUWxPj3yZCzvH
  • 156f4ae5e84c2a86f70fff333edc20e38e9299e6db65f43295c2e49813665b53:1
  • value  240889069
    address  36uQ6dfg3C6bTXvCUGYyK9Lqp5Mqkap1cA